Cost of Living FAQs

Is it cheaper to rent or buy in Atlantic Highlands Borough?

Based on median housing data, renting is currently more affordable on a monthly basis in Atlantic Highlands Borough. The estimated all-in monthly cost for renting is $2,230, while owning a median-priced home with a 20% down payment is roughly $4,884 per month (a difference of $2,654).

How much do utilities cost in Atlantic Highlands Borough?

The average monthly utility cost (electricity and natural gas) for a typical home in Atlantic Highlands Borough is approximately $251. This estimate uses local utility rate schedules combined with median energy consumption profiles.

What is a good salary to live comfortably in Atlantic Highlands Borough?

To comfortably afford the median rent and utilities in Atlantic Highlands Borough without exceeding the recommended 30% housing-to-income threshold, a household should earn a gross salary of approximately $89,200 per year.
